  1. I just bought a dvd writer for my laptop off ebay, I want to check if it has the technical specs,like drive speed, burning speed etc, that the seller said it would have. How would do I do that?? What software do I use?

    Nero InfoTool is a easy program to use.

  5. DVDInfoPro is also likely to give you the info that you want.
